## Approvals: Undo/Redo in SketchForge

Undo/redo in the SketchForge canvas now uses a bounded command stack (200 entries). Redo is invalidated on any new edit. Cross-tab undo remains out of scope for the 4.2 release. Release gate requires sign-off on the stack-corruption regression suite and the collaborative-merge edge cases listed in the test plan. No further approvals are needed beyond QA. Before tagging the build, confirm final sign-off with the approver named below.

account owner for fajep-yagef: Kasix Eliiel

# Break-Glass: Catalog Cache Invalidation

Scope: the Pinrow product catalog at Veldstone Retail. If stale prices persist after a purge and the Hollowmere invalidation queue is wedged, use break-glass to flush the edge tier directly. Contractors: get verbal sign-off from the catalog lead first. Steps: open the Hollowmere admin shell, select emergency-flush, confirm the tenant, and run it once — repeated flushes thrash the origin. Access is logged and expires after 20 minutes. Unseal the admin shell with the passphrase below.

recovery phrase for kahop-tajog: istix-casvan

To: Executive Team
From: Finance, Quellerton Analytics
Subject: Q3 budget request

We are requesting an additional allocation for the Skylark tooling upgrade and two contract hires. Current run-rate leaves no buffer for the autumn release, and deferral would push delivery into next year. Detailed line items are attached. Approval is needed before the planning freeze. Our reasoning connects to the strategic note below.

confidential, kagup-bafog: Fraaxax Group is in early talks to buy Soroxox Group for about $343.8 million. The Olidor launch date is June 14, and nothing goes to the press before then. Legal wants the Aldmirek Logistics term sheet signed before July 23.

## Deploying the Gatewick Proctor Queue

Deploys are pretty painless: push to main, wait for the pipeline, then watch the queue drain dashboard for five minutes. If candidates pile up mid-exam, roll back first and ask questions later — the queue replays safely. Everything the workers care about lives in one config block, shown here for reference.

settings of bafof-yagef:
JOROX_PIN=8740
JOROX_TENANT=pelox
JOROX_METRICS_HOST=metrics.jorox.qorvelworks.internal
JOROX_SEAL=seal_c78f63c1
JOROX_STANDBY_TEAM=norax